Mary T. Ryan-Beaudin's Obituary
Mary Maureen Ryan-Beaudin, age 89, of Georgetown, DE, passed away on July 21, 2022, at Delaware Hospice Center. She was born on May 19, 1933, in the Bronx, NY, the beloved daughter of the late Michael and Mary (McGuyan) Flahive.
After graduating high school, Mary’s passion to help those around her led to a lifelong career in nursing. After earning her Associate Degree and becoming a Registered Nurse. She expertly and lovingly cared for thousands of patients during her career at Holy Name Hospital in Teaneck, NJ. Later in her career she went on to become the co-owner of Modern Care Nursing Agency, which gave her a great sense of pride and fulfillment.
Mary was active in the communities she lived in and was formerly a member of the Emerson New Jersey Ambulance Corp. After moving to southern Delaware, she became a member of the American Legion Post 17 of Lewes, DE. She enjoyed spending time and made many friendships as a member of the Red Hat Society and also served as a Columbiette in several parishes. Above all else, the time she spent with those she held dear to her heart was what she cherished most. She was a loving and devoted wife, mother, grandmother, great-grandmother, and friend. Loved by many, she will be deeply missed by all who had the good fortune to know her.
